心房細動患者におけるP波異常の流行と進行

Arto Relander1, Johanna Kääriä1, Samuli Jaakkola1

  • 1Heart Center, Turku University Hospital and University of Turku, Turku, Finland.

Heart rhythm
|August 31, 2025
PubMed
まとめ

P波異常 (PWA) は,老化や心血管疾患によって引き起こされ,心房細動 (AF) の患者に頻繁に発生し,急速に進行します. これらの心電図の変化は,AFの高い流行率と進行率を示しています.

科学分野:

  • 心臓病科
  • エレクトロカルジオグラフィー

背景:

  • P波指数は心電図 (ECG) の心血管疾患である心房細動 (AF) や脳卒中に関連しています.
  • これらのP波異常 (PWA) の安定性および進行に関するデータは限られている.

研究 の 目的:

  • 心房細動 (AF) の患者におけるP波異常 (PWA) の流行,進行,およびリスク因子を調査する.

主な方法:

  • 急性AFのために心臓転換 (CV) を受けた1316人の3つのシヌスリズムECGを分析した.
  • P-波の持続時間,P-末端の力,心房間ブロックの基準,およびP-波の形状に基づいた中等および広範なPWAを定義します.

主要な成果:

  • 正常P波から中度および広範囲のPWAへの有意な進行は,心臓転換前および後の両方とも観察されました.
  • フォローアップでは38. 7%が中程度のPWAと33. 5%が広範囲のPWAでした.
  • 持続的な/ 進行的なPWAの独立リスク要因には,年齢,心不全,高血圧,血管疾患,以前のAF,頻繁なCV,左心室高縮,および広範なQRS複合体が含まれています.

結論:

  • P- 波異常 (PWA) は高い頻度で,AF患者では急速に進行する.
  • 進行は主に老化,慢性心血管疾患,再発性AFエピソードによって影響されます.
